Python讨论群是一个集合Python编程爱好者的社群,通过互相交流、分享经验和解决问题,共同进步。在Python讨论群中,我们可以获得各种各样的帮助,学到更多的知识,还可以结识志同道合的朋友。本文将从多个方面对Python讨论群进行详细阐述。
一、群规
1、尊重他人
在Python讨论群中,成员之间应相互尊重,避免使用侮辱、攻击性语言或行为。大家应友善、包容地对待不同观点和水平的成员。
2、遵守规定
为了维护良好的群环境,Python讨论群有一些规定,如不发布广告、不发送垃圾信息等。成员需要遵守这些规定,保持群的纯净和秩序。
3、分享与学习
群成员可以自由地分享自己的代码、项目和开发经验,同样也可以提问和寻求帮助。大家在这里共同成长和学习,互相支持和鼓励。
二、交流与分享
1、问题求助
Python讨论群是一个解决问题的好地方。当我们遇到问题时,可以在群里向其他成员请教和求助。有经验的成员会给予一些建议和解决方案,帮助我们找到问题的答案。
def fibonacci(n):
if n <= 0:
return []
elif n == 1:
return [0]
elif n == 2:
return [0, 1]
else:
fib_list = [0, 1]
for i in range(2, n):
fib_list.append(fib_list[i-1] + fib_list[i-2])
return fib_list
n = 10
print(fibonacci(n)) # 输出前n个斐波那契数列
例如,我们在群里遇到一个编程问题,需要输出前n个斐波那契数列。我们可以向群里的成员请教,得到如上代码的解决方案。
2、经验分享
Python讨论群中的成员来自不同的领域和背景,都有自己的编程经验和技巧。在群里,我们可以分享自己的经验和心得,让其他人受益。通过分享,我们可以了解更多的编程技术和最佳实践。
import matplotlib.pyplot as plt
x = [1, 2, 3, 4, 5]
y = [2, 4, 6, 8, 10]
plt.plot(x, y)
plt.xlabel('X')
plt.ylabel('Y')
plt.title('Plot Example')
plt.show()
例如,我们可以分享如上代码来展示如何使用Matplotlib库绘制简单的折线图。其他成员可以通过学习和借鉴这个例子,掌握相关的数据可视化技巧。
三、资源推荐
1、教程和文档
Python讨论群中的成员经常会分享一些优质的教程和文档,供大家学习和参考。这些教程和文档可以帮助我们更好地理解和掌握Python编程语言。推荐的资源包括官方文档、在线教程、书籍等。
2、学习项目
在Python讨论群中,我们可以找到一些有趣的学习项目,用于练习和提高自己的编程能力。这些项目可以涉及各个领域,如数据分析、机器学习、Web开发等。通过参与这些项目,我们可以锻炼实际问题解决能力。
import requests
url = 'https://api.github.com/users/octocat'
response = requests.get(url)
data = response.json()
print(data['name']) # 输出用户名
例如,我们可以通过上述代码来获取GitHub上某个用户的用户名。这个代码片段可以作为一个学习项目的一部分,用来访问Web API并处理返回的JSON数据。
Python讨论群提供了一个良好的交流和学习平台,通过互相帮助和分享,我们可以共同进步。在群中,每个成员都可以发挥自己的特长和优势,为群的发展做出贡献。希望大家能够积极参与讨论,享受其中带来的乐趣和收获。
原创文章,作者:FKUY,如若转载,请注明出处:https://www.beidandianzhu.com/g/3866.html